1st Coverall Co Ltd
7 months ago
Ian Crellin
1974 Rapport Ltd
2 years ago
Ian Crellin
3M United Kingdom Plc
2 years ago
Ian Crellin
As one of the world’s leading suppliers of safety and protective equipment our goal is to ensure we satisfy your needs through the provision of exceptional leadership, expertise, quality and…